Basic Concepts of Rear Clutches
A rear clutch is a mechanical device within a transmission system that engages and disengages to transfer power from the engine to the transmission. It allows the driver to shift gears smoothly. When activated, the rear clutch connects the input shaft to the output shaft, enabling power transmission. When disengaged, it allows the driver to change gears without interrupting the power flow 1.

Role of Part 3201375 Rear Clutch in Clutch Systems
The part 3201375 Rear Clutch is an integral component within the clutch system of a vehicle, facilitating the seamless transfer of power from the engine to the transmission. This component operates in conjunction with several other elements to ensure efficient and reliable performance.
When the driver engages the clutch pedal, the Rear Clutch disengages the engine from the transmission, allowing the driver to shift gears without causing damage to the drivetrain. This action is made possible through the interaction of the Rear Clutch with the pressure plate, which is spring-loaded to apply constant pressure to the clutch disc. The clutch disc, in turn, is splined to the input shaft of the transmission, enabling power transfer.
The Rear Clutch also works in harmony with the release bearing and throw-out bearing. When the clutch pedal is pressed, these bearings move the pressure plate away from the clutch disc, thereby disengaging the clutch. Upon releasing the pedal, the spring pressure re-engages the clutch, reconnecting the engine to the transmission.
Furthermore, the Rear Clutch is designed to handle the specific torque and load requirements of the vehicle, ensuring smooth and consistent power delivery. Its proper function is essential for the overall performance and durability of the clutch system, contributing to a driver’s control and the vehicle’s efficiency.
